Common Signs of Poor Workmanship
Having an awareness of red flags during and after your project is crucial. While some issues may be easily spotted from the ground or inside your home, others require closer inspection or even professional evaluation. Here are several indicators that suggest subpar craftsmanship:
Visible Gaps or Misalignment
When inspecting roofing work, look for gaps between shingles or misaligned tiles. Properly installed roofs should have uniform alignment without any visible spaces that could allow water penetration.
Unusual Wear Patterns
After installation, monitor how your roof performs through different weather conditions. Uneven wear may indicate improper installation techniques or inadequate materials.
Excessive Debris
If there is an unusual amount of debris left behind post-installation—like nails, leftover shingles, or other construction waste—it may signal negligence on the contractor's part regarding site cleanliness and safety protocols.
Poorly Pitched Roofs
Roofs must have adequate pitch to facilitate proper drainage; otherwise, standing water can accumulate leading to leaks and mold growth. Inspecting whether your new roof has been pitched correctly is essential.
Inconsistent Flashing Installation
Flashing is crucial for directing water away from joints and vulnerable areas like chimneys or vents. If flashing looks improperly installed or missing altogether, this could lead to long-term damage.

The Role of Communication
An often-overlooked aspect of successful contracting is communication between you and your chosen professional. Establishing clear lines of communication allows you to voice concerns early on while also ensuring that expectations are met throughout the project's duration.
Asking the Right Questions
During initial consultations with potential contractors in Montgomery IN—whether they specialize in commercial roofing or residential work—it’s important to ask specific questions about their processes and past projects:
- What type of materials do you recommend for my project? Can I see examples of similar work you've completed? What warranty do you offer on labor?
Such inquiries provide insight into their level of professionalism while also allowing you to gauge their willingness to engage with clients openly about potential pitfalls.
